Resolution: standard / high Figure 4.
Detection of NaV1.8 mRNA in the sciatic nerve. A. NaV1.8 mRNA levels were significantly increased in the sciatic nerve ipsilateral
to the injury site as compared to contralateral and uninjured DRG. (n = 3; p < 0.05,
one-way ANOVA with Tukey post-hoc). B. NaV1.8 mRNA levels in SNE-injured DRG were
not significantly different from those of uninjured DRG (n = 4 for uninjured DRG and
n = 3 for all other samples). C: Southern blot of the Nav1.8 3' RACE product from
contralateral and ipsilateral sciatic nerve. Note the presence of a distinct band
representing the expected 3'RACE product of 830 bp. Sequencing of the RACE product
confirmed the presence of the 3' end of the NaV1.8 coding region as well as the NaV1.8
3' un-translated region and polyA tail. Tissue was harvested 2 weeks after SNE.
